A teacher at Sullivan Central High School was recently notified that he would be suspended for three days without pay for “unprofessional behavior.”

On Sept. 3, Jeremy McLaughlin, who teaches physics, received a letter of reprimand and notice of the suspension from Sullivan County Schools Director David Cox. Some of the complaints drew attention to crude language and “unprofessional behavior” on McLaughlin’s personal Facebook page, Cox said. In the letter, Cox said that he and other school officials “recently received a number of complaints” about McLaughlin.

Screenshots of the posts in question — which the complaints said were publicly visible for a while — were included in the documents released to the Herald Courier.
